Address
Prince Sultan Bin Abdulaziz Rd. Delmon Building, No. 4380, P.O. Box 77072
34235 Al Khobar
Saudi Arabia
Contact information
moc/fli//ask/fli | |
Phone | +966 / 13 / 847 7345 |
Fax | +966 / 11 / 464 4616 |
Get in touch
Christian Nunner
moc/fli//rennun/naitsirhc | |
Phone | +966 (0) 11 465 4145 |
For job applications and job-related questions, please contact jobs@ilf.com or the HR partner named within the job descriptions listed here: https://www.ilf.com/career/jobs/